探索未来搜索——Golang版Qdrant客户端深度剖析

探索未来搜索——Golang版Qdrant客户端深度剖析

go-clientGo client for Qdrant vector search engine项目地址:https://gitcode.com/gh_mirrors/goc/go-client

在大数据和AI日益蓬勃的今天,高效精准的向量搜索变得尤为重要。今天,我们要推荐一个开源神器——Golang Qdrant客户端,它为开发者打开了一扇通往高效向量搜索引擎的大门。

项目介绍

Golang Qdrant客户端是专门针对Qdrant向量搜索引擎设计的Go语言接口,使得在Go应用中集成高级的向量搜索功能变得简单快捷。通过这个客户端,开发人员可以轻松地利用Qdrant的强大能力,实现复杂的数据检索任务,特别是在处理高维度数据集时,它的表现尤为出色。

技术分析

简洁安装

安装过程极其直观,一条简单的命令即可:

go get github.com/qdrant/go-client

这使得快速启动项目成为可能,缩短了开发准备时间。

集成gRPC

Qdrant支持gRPC接口,意味着低延迟和高效的通信机制。通过调整环境变量或配置文件设置gRPC端口,即可启用这一功能,让服务间通讯更加流畅。

强大的示例支撑

提供了详尽的代码示例,从连接服务器到复杂的上传、搜索和过滤操作一应俱全,帮助开发者迅速上手,并且对于认证请求(如API Key和TLS)也有专门的例子,显示了其在安全方面的考虑。

应用场景

  • 智能推荐系统:电商平台、视频应用可利用其高效向量匹配,个性化推送商品或内容。
  • 自然语言处理:在语义理解和文本检索中,Qdrant能显著提升相似文档的查找速度。
  • 图像识别:将图像特征转化为向量,快速找到视觉上相似的图片。
  • 机器学习模型管理:高效地管理并检索训练好的模型。

项目特点

  1. 高性能: 基于Qdrant底层的优化,无论是处理大规模向量数据还是进行实时查询,都能保持卓越性能。
  2. 易用性: 设计简洁的API,即使是Go新手也能迅速整合进自己的项目中。
  3. 安全性增强: 支持TLS和API Key认证,保证云环境中的数据交互安全可靠。
  4. 全面文档:详尽的文档和示例,大幅降低了学习成本,加速开发流程。
  5. 社区活跃: 加入一个充满活力的社区,不断更新和改进确保项目的长期可行性。

总之,Golang Qdrant客户端以其强大的技术支持和友好的开发者体验,成为现代应用中不可或缺的一部分,尤其是在追求极致搜索体验的领域。无论你是数据科学家、AI工程师还是普通的Web开发者,都不妨尝试一下这款工具,它可能会让你的应用程序在数据检索方面实现质的飞跃。开启你的高效向量探索之旅,就从这里开始!

go-clientGo client for Qdrant vector search engine项目地址:https://gitcode.com/gh_mirrors/goc/go-client

  • 1
    点赞
  • 3
    收藏
    觉得还不错? 一键收藏
  • 打赏
    打赏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

司莹嫣Maude

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值